Railway communication cable lines are typically made up of several different types of cables, each designed to carry out a specific function within the railway system. For example, there may be cables dedicated to carrying train schedule information, while others may be responsible for transmitting signals or operational instructions. The cables themselves may be made from a variety of materials, including copper, fiber optic, or even steel, depending on the specific requirements of the railway system.
In addition to the cables themselves, railway communication systems also rely on various types of equipment to install and maintain these cables. This equipment may include cable trays, cable ties, and other fixtures that help keep the cables organized and secure. The maintenance of these cables is crucial to ensure that the railway system can continue to operate efficiently and safely.
Railway communication cable lines also play a crucial role in railway safety. By transmitting signals and operational instructions, these cables help ensure that trains can operate safely and efficiently within the railway network. For example, if a train approaches a signal that indicates it should stop, the communication cables will transmit this signal to the train’s control system, allowing the train to obey the signal and come to a safe stop.
